非接触式测速系统是一种不依赖于任何物理接触就能测量物体速度的技术。在现代社会,这样的系统被广泛应用于工业、科研以及交通等多个领域。特别是随着数字图像处理技术的发展,非接触式测速技术在精确度和实时性方面有了质的飞跃。
在本文中,作者李玲和李洋涛研究了基于FPGA的非接触式测速系统。FPGA,即现场可编程门阵列,是一种可以通过编程来配置的集成电路。FPGA的并行处理能力以及可重配置性使得它非常适合作为非接触式测速系统的硬件平台。
本研究的开发板选择了Altera公司的DE2开发板。DE2是Altera公司特别针对大学教学和研究机构推出的一款FPGA多媒体开发平台,它不仅有丰富的外设和多媒体特性,还有灵活可靠的外围接口设计。在此基础上,研究者使用了Terasic公司为DE2平台提供的CCD摄像头模块和彩色LCD模块。CCD(电荷耦合器件)摄像头模块可以捕捉到高速运动物体的图像信息,而彩色LCD模块则可用于显示处理结果。
在系统开发过程中,研究者首先利用DE2开发板上的硬件资源采集图像数据,然后将数据通过接口传送至DE2开发板。接着DE2开发板负责对数字图像进行压缩、保存、识别及相关的运算处理。最终,通过VGA模块将图像效果显示出来,并且通过DE2开发板上的数码管显示计算结果。
Quartus II软件是Altera公司提供的一个用于FPGA开发的软件环境。它能提供完整的多平台设计环境,直接满足特定设计的需要,为可编程芯片系统(SOPC)提供全面的设计环境。在本研究中,Quartus II软件被用来对Verilog代码进行编译和调试。Verilog是一种硬件描述语言(HDL),它用于对电子系统进行建模和描述。在这个项目中,研究者通过对Verilog代码进行优化和处理,实现了算法的具体方式,并最终完成了速度测量的目的。
开发非接触式测速系统的目的是为了克服传统接触式测速方法的局限性。接触式测速方法通常需要物体与测量设备直接接触,这不仅限制了测量速度的范围,而且对物体本身可能造成损坏。而非接触式测速则可以实现远距离测量,提高了安全性,扩展了测量的场景和范围。
总结来说,本文通过使用DE2开发板和CCD摄像头模块,结合Quartus II软件和Verilog硬件描述语言,实现了一套非接触式测速系统。该系统不仅具有较高的测量精度和处理速度,而且具备较强的实时性和可靠性。这项技术的应用前景非常广泛,对许多需要高速数据采集和处理的场合有着重要的意义。